Is Aaron Rodgers playing this week? Latest news, updates on Steelers QB's status for Week 12 vs. Bears
  • Aaron Rodgers' status for the upcoming game against the Chicago Bears remains uncertain as he recovers from a wrist injury, which will not require surgery. The Steelers are evaluating his condition closely.
  • This situation is critical for the Pittsburgh Steelers as they aim to maintain their position in the AFC North, where they are currently leading but facing pressure from the Baltimore Ravens.
  • The uncertainty surrounding Rodgers' injury highlights the challenges teams face in managing player health, especially as playoff implications loom and the Steelers consider potential quarterback additions.

Bears QB Caleb Williams looking for accuracy fix in time to face Aaron Rodgers and Steelers
NeutralSports
Chicago Bears quarterback Caleb Williams, who grew up idolizing Aaron Rodgers, is preparing to face him when the Pittsburgh Steelers visit Soldier Field on Sunday. Williams' performance has been under scrutiny, with his completion percentage falling below 60% and passer rating below 90. Bears coach Ben Johnson acknowledges the disparity between Williams' current play and Rodgers' established career.
Steelers’ Aaron Rodgers pokes fun at Bears fans with Week 12 status in doubt
NeutralSports
The status of Pittsburgh Steelers quarterback Aaron Rodgers for the upcoming Week 12 game against the Chicago Bears remains uncertain due to a fractured left wrist sustained in the previous game against the Cincinnati Bengals. Rodgers did not participate in practice on Wednesday, raising concerns about his availability for the crucial matchup.
